Elizabeth Honer named Royal Academy of Dance chief executive.
The Royal Academy of Dance has named Elizabeth Honer its new chief executive.
Honer will take up the position from January 21, succeeding Tim Arthur, who stood down at the end of 2024.
Formerly a member of the RAD’s finance committee, Honer has also been chief executive of a Treasury commercial agency as well as a director at the Foreign, Commonwealth and Development Office.
Her roles in the charity sector include trusteeships at the Vision Foundation and the Dartington International Summer School Foundation following early-career fundraising for the Academy of St Martin in the Fields.
Her appointment to the RAD follows her receipt of a Companion of the Order of the Bath in the 2024 King’s birthday honours, and sees her head up an organisation at which she still takes dance classes.
She has also supported the Acosta Dance Centre and been a member of the London Ballet Circle.
Honer said she was “thrilled” by her appointment, adding: “The RAD is dear to my heart, having taken RAD exams as a child and continuing to participate to this day.
“The RAD has an exciting future ahead and I look forward to leading the organisation’s new strategy and building on our incredible history.”

Strictly Come Dancing star Kai Widdrington is set to dazzle audiences across the UK & Ireland with his thrilling new 2025 dance tour Kai – Evolution.
Following his stunning performances on the hit BBC show, Kai is now set to bring his exceptional talent and charismatic stage presence to theatres nationwide with his inaugural solo dance tour.
Kai – Evolution promises to take audience members on a mesmerising journey through an array of dance genres, showcasing Kai’s versatility and passion for dance.
The tour will feature breathtaking choreography, stunning visuals, and an incredible cast of dancers. Audiences will be able to enjoy a mix of classic Ballroom, Latin, and innovative dance routines that showcase Kai’s extraordinary skill and creativity.
Speaking about his delight at taking his brand-new show around the UK and Ireland, Kai said: “I’m thrilled to bring this show to life and share my love for dance with fans. It has always been a dream of mine to do a nationwide solo tour and I can’t wait to make it a reality. This show will be a celebration of my love for all things music and dance, and I am extremely excited to get to share this experience with everyone, both in the UK and Ireland.”Tour Commences 14th May 2025

General News & Sighting
- Melissa Hamilton was promoted to Principle dancer at The Royal Ballet.
- Marianela Nunez was made an OBE in the New Year’s Honours List.
- The Royal Academy of Dance has appointed Elizabeth Honer as its new Chief Executive.
- Strictly’s first drag artist, Tayce, and pro dancer Kai won the Christmas Special.
- Former Strictly star Giovanni Pernice won the Italian version of the show with his celebrity partner Bianca.
- “Clueless” has announced the full West End cast for its opening at the Trafalgar Theatre on the 15th of February. Cher will be played by Emma Flynn with cover by Sophie Elmes. The choreography is by Kelly Devine.
- Birmingham Royal Ballet Chief Executive Caroline Miller passed away after a long illness.
Future Dance Events News
- “Scissorhandz: A Musical Reinvented” will have its European premiere at the Southwark Playhouse Elephant on the 23rd of January 2025. The choreography is by Alexzandra Sarmiento.
- “Hercules” will open at the Theatre Royal Drury Lane on the 6th of June 2025. It will star Luke Brady and have choreography by Casey Nicholaw and Tanisha Scott.
- “The Great Gatsby” will open in the West End at the London Coliseum on the 11th of April 2025. It has choreography by Dominique Kelley.
- Lead casting has been announced for the UK premiere of “Muriel’s Wedding The Musical”. It will star Megan Ellis and Annabel Marlow. The choreography is by Andrew Hallsworth. The show will run from the 10th of April until the 10th of May 2025 at the Curve theatre in Leicester.
- The full cast has been announced for Sondheim’s final musical “Here We are”. It will star Tracie Bennett and Denis O’ Hare and have choreography by Sam Pinkleton. The show will run at the National Theatre in April 2025.
- “Clueless” is coming to the West End. The show will have choreography by Kelly Devine and will open at the Trafalgar theatre on the 15th of February 2025.
- The world premiere of the new musical “Alfred Hitchcock Presents” will be staged in Bath in the Spring of 2025.
- “The Lightening Thief” is set to open at The Other Palace in London from the 23rd of November until the 2nd of February 2025. It will be directed and choreographed by Lizzie Gee.
- Disney’s animated classic “Hercules” is headed for the Theatre Royal Drury Lane in the Summer of 2025. It will have choreography by Casey Nicholaw and Tanisha Scott.
- The world premiere of “Wild Rose” will run from the 6th of March until the 5th of April 2025 at the Lyceum theatre in Scotland. It has choreography by Steven Hoggett.
- “Calamity Jane” will tour the UK and Ireland before a West End run in 2025. It has choreography by Nick Winston.
- The Leeds Playhouse will host the world premiere of “Coraline – A Musical” from the 11th of April to the 11th of May 2025 before the show embarks on a UK tour. The choreography is by EJ Boyle.
- “Moulin Rouge! The Musical” is set to embark on a world tour in 2025. The new production will launch in the UK while its West End staging will continue its run at the Piccadilly theatre.
- A stage musical based on Prince’s film and album “Purple Rain” is in the works with producer Orin Wolf.
- “Some Like It Hot” is coming to the West End in 2025. It will be directed and choreographed by Casey Nicholaw.

- “Wicked” is now available on Amazon Prime. It has officially become the highest grossing film version of a stage production with global sales of $634m. Last week it won the Golden Globe for “Cinematic and Box Office Achievement”.
